Mesothelioma Attorney

A mesothelioma lawyer can assist victims bring a asbestos lawsuit against responsible companies. Many mesothelioma cases settle rather than go to trial before a judge or jury.

patient-lying-down-on-ct-scanner-2022-03However, patients should make sure they choose an experienced mesothelioma lawyer to make sure they file their claim within the timeframe of limitations. Every state has laws known as statutes of limitation which determine the time for which claimants can file legal claims.

Mesothelioma affects the inner organs' linings like the abdomen or lungs. It usually develops after inhaling or ingesting asbestos and the effects may be delayed for 50 years or more after the initial exposure. In Washington, a mesothelioma lawyer can assist individuals in holding negligent asbestos producers accountable for their exposure, and subsequent diagnosis of mesothelioma.

In addition to helping with mesothelioma attorney west Virginia cases in addition, an Washington mesothelioma attorney dallas mesothelioma can assist in wrongful death claims of loved ones who have died from asbestos-related diseases. The victims deserve financial compensation from asbestos companies who did not inform workers or the general public about the dangers of asbestos.

The majority of mesothelioma cases are settled out of court. Settlements from these cases can aid victims and their families cope with the financial burden of this kind of cancer.

In 2017, SGB lawyers for mesothelioma clinched the $16.6-million verdict for the widowed of a paper mill employee in King County, Washington. The verdict was the biggest mesothelioma verdict in the history of the state.

SGB's experience in dealing with asbestos claims in Washington has helped set the standards for how mesothelioma lawyers should represent their clients in this jurisdiction. Their work has led them into the development of Washington asbestos laws that benefit all future victims. These laws ensure that the rights of victims are secured and that their lawyers are able to advocate for them in any courtroom.

Many people in Washington have been diagnosed with mesothelioma. It is an extremely rare and serious cancer. These victims are entitled to financial compensation from the manufacturers who put profit ahead of the lives of people. Through filing a lawsuit mesothelioma patients can seek compensation to cover medical treatment, lost wages and other expenses.

Mesothelioma victims who were exposed to asbestos in the Washington area could be entitled to workers' compensation. These benefits can cover medical costs, allow the patient to return to work following the diagnosis of mesothelioma, and even help a family member stay home with the patient. Veterans who were exposed while in the military to asbestos might also be eligible for Social Security Disability benefits.

Washington has seen hundreds of veterans diagnosed with mesothelioma. Many of these veterans worked in jobs that required asbestos exposure, like shipbuilding, timber, petrochemical, and aluminum industries. Others may have been exposed via secondhand exposure or at home. In 2007, a mesothelioma victim's lawsuit in Washington confirmed that asbestos companies had a responsibility to warn about the dangers of secondhand, or take-home exposure.

Cases Won

Mesothelioma is a devastating disease and treatment can be expensive. A mesothelioma lawyer can assist patients to receive the compensation they deserve for medical treatment as well as lost income and other expenses.

A reputable mesothelioma lawyer has years of experience representing asbestos victims. They will be familiar with the ins and outs of mesothelioma cases and will be able negotiate effectively with insurance companies on behalf of their clients. They will also be able to calculate the total amount of compensation a victim, or their family, is entitled to.

SGB has represented asbestos victims longer than any law firm in Washington and has secured millions of dollars in settlements and verdicts on their behalf. SGB has won a number of important asbestos cases in Washington and is the source for some of the biggest mesothelioma cases in the state.

SGB is one example. SGB obtained a $16.6-million verdict following a trial on behalf of the widow of a deceased worker at a paper mill who was diagnosed with mesothelioma. SGB also won the highest mesothelioma verdict in King County, and the largest asbestos award in Kitsap County. This included the $1.3million verdict which led to the Washington Supreme Court confirming the verdict and overturning a lawful damage cap.

Washington has seen an impressive increase in the number of mesothelioma deaths, and this rate is higher than the national average. A mesothelioma lawyer can help resolve a case quickly and satisfy the needs of the patient.

Compensation

Patients diagnosed with mesothelioma or another asbestos-related disease are entitled to financial compensation. Families could be eligible to be compensated for the loss of income as well as funeral expenses, medical bills as well as pain and suffering. It can be overwhelming to pursue a legal claim after a mesothelioma diagnoses. A mesothelioma attorney can assist in constructing a strong case to hold negligent parties accountable. A qualified attorney can determine if the patient or their family are entitled to compensation.

Asbestos-related injuries in Washington may be eligible for Social Security Disability, Social Security Pension benefits, or workers' compensation. Patients diagnosed with mesothelioma could also be eligible to receive compensation from trusts set up by bankruptcy asbestos companies. Trusts have been set up to support families of victims, and generally don't adhere to the statutes of limitation in each state (SOL). A mesothelioma lawyer in Washington can ensure that claims are filed within the proper time frame.

Attorneys at mesothelioma firms have years of experience in asbestos litigation and their work has contributed to the development of laws in Washington regarding asbestos cases. "Good law" is when a lawyer's cases set a standard or rule that will benefit future clients.

Asbestos was used in numerous industries across the nation, including construction, energy, and shipbuilding. Washington residents were affected by asbestos exposure at these places and at many other locations as well. Between 1999 between 1999 and 2017 9,200 people in Washington died from asbestos-related diseases, and most of these were victims of mesothelioma.

A mesothelioma lawyer may charge clients for photocopies and court filing fees, as well as other expenses related to the case. Most mesothelioma attorneys will work on a contingent basis so that patients and their families don't have to pay upfront costs. The lawyers will generally only collect payment if they win the case. The fees will be deducted from the final settlement. This kind of arrangement is known as a "legal fees agreement". It is the most beneficial arrangement for mesothelioma patients and their families.
